This is typically faster and less expensive than visiting dealers. The cost of the cost of a BMW key replacement can differ based on the model and year of your vehicle. Older models are more likely to have limited availability of key blanks, which may result in higher prices. Newer models could have advanced security features, which could also increase the cost. Also, you should take into consideration the amount of time you'll have to spend waiting for an expert locksmith or dealer to offer service, which can add to your overall cost. It's important to keep in mind that a locksmith can't replace your BMW key if you haven't provided proof of ownership. In order to get a replacement key you'll need verification documents like a driver's license or insurance card. Also, you'll need the VIN that is a 17-character number that contains details about your car like its year of manufacture and model. They will also assist you to save money by repairing your key fob rather than purchasing a new one. The key fob is an essential component of every BMW model. It is designed to offer security by connecting to the immobilizer of the vehicle. This will stop criminals from making hotwires in the ignition and stealing the door locks. This communication is carried out through the transponder chip on the key fob. Transponder chips that are damaged or malfunctioning could cause your car not to start, or the key to stop responding or getting stuck in the ignition.
